Hungary-Philippines Exploratory Dialogue on Science and Technology Cooperation

The Embassy of Hungary in Manila and the Department of Science and Technology of the Philippines organized an Exploratory Dialogue Online Event on 28 April 2021, aiming to explore new areas of science and technology cooperation between the two countries.

Philippines and Hungary pursue stronger cooperation at the 2nd Session of the Joint Commission on Economic Cooperation

The Second Session of the Philippine-Hungarian Joint Commission on Economic Cooperation was held in Makati City, Metro Manila on 3-4 December 2020. The Philippine delegation was headed by H.E. Dr. Ceferino S. Rodolfo, Undersecretary for Industry Development and Trade Policy of the Department of Trade and Industry of the Republic of the Philippines and Co-Chair of the Philippine Side of the Commission.
